mirror of
https://github.com/tuxbox-fork-migrations/recycled-ni-neutrino.git
synced 2025-08-28 07:51:11 +02:00
fix aac audio when streaming, thx DboxOldie
Origin commit data
------------------
Commit: da944aa9bf
Author: max_10 <max_10@gmx.de>
Date: 2019-05-03 (Fri, 03 May 2019)
Origin message was:
------------------
- fix aac audio when streaming, thx DboxOldie
This commit is contained in:
@@ -102,6 +102,10 @@ CGenPsi::CGenPsi()
|
|||||||
memset(dvbsubpid, 0, sizeof(dvbsubpid));
|
memset(dvbsubpid, 0, sizeof(dvbsubpid));
|
||||||
neac3 = 0;
|
neac3 = 0;
|
||||||
memset(eac3_pid, 0, sizeof(eac3_pid));
|
memset(eac3_pid, 0, sizeof(eac3_pid));
|
||||||
|
naac = 0;
|
||||||
|
memset(aac_pid, 0, sizeof(aac_pid));
|
||||||
|
naacp = 0;
|
||||||
|
memset(aacp_pid, 0, sizeof(aacp_pid));
|
||||||
}
|
}
|
||||||
|
|
||||||
uint32_t CGenPsi::calc_crc32psi(uint8_t *dst, const uint8_t *src, uint32_t len)
|
uint32_t CGenPsi::calc_crc32psi(uint8_t *dst, const uint8_t *src, uint32_t len)
|
||||||
|
@@ -472,6 +472,10 @@ void CStreamManager::AddPids(int fd, CZapitChannel *channel, stream_pids_t &pids
|
|||||||
printf("CStreamManager::AddPids: genpsi apid %x (%d)\n", *it, atype);
|
printf("CStreamManager::AddPids: genpsi apid %x (%d)\n", *it, atype);
|
||||||
if (channel->getAudioChannel(i)->audioChannelType == CZapitAudioChannel::EAC3) {
|
if (channel->getAudioChannel(i)->audioChannelType == CZapitAudioChannel::EAC3) {
|
||||||
psi.addPid(*it, EN_TYPE_AUDIO_EAC3, atype, channel->getAudioChannel(i)->description.c_str());
|
psi.addPid(*it, EN_TYPE_AUDIO_EAC3, atype, channel->getAudioChannel(i)->description.c_str());
|
||||||
|
} else if (channel->getAudioChannel(i)->audioChannelType == CZapitAudioChannel::AAC) {
|
||||||
|
psi.addPid(*it, EN_TYPE_AUDIO_AAC, atype, channel->getAudioChannel(i)->description.c_str());
|
||||||
|
} else if (channel->getAudioChannel(i)->audioChannelType == CZapitAudioChannel::AACPLUS) {
|
||||||
|
psi.addPid(*it, EN_TYPE_AUDIO_AACP, atype, channel->getAudioChannel(i)->description.c_str());
|
||||||
} else {
|
} else {
|
||||||
psi.addPid(*it, EN_TYPE_AUDIO, atype, channel->getAudioChannel(i)->description.c_str());
|
psi.addPid(*it, EN_TYPE_AUDIO, atype, channel->getAudioChannel(i)->description.c_str());
|
||||||
}
|
}
|
||||||
|
Reference in New Issue
Block a user